The 2014 Paris Mondial de l'Automobile or 2014 Paris Motor Show took place from 4 October to 19 October 2014 on 'Automobile and Fashion' theme.

The Automobile and Fashion Exhibition

The 2014 Paris Motor Show will be based on the 'Automobile and Fashion' theme. Around 40 cars will be the part of exhibition in partnership with INA at Pavilion 8. All these cars will be from the year before 1900 to the current year and that includes pre-war, post-war, art years and environment-friendly customization of the contemporary era as well.

Electric and Hybrid Vehicle Testing Center

The 2014 Paris Motor Show will host an event for the testing of electric and hybrid vehicle testing at the pavilion 2/1. This will be the first time that the live testing for the visitor will be done at an automobile event. The car manufacturers like BMW, Courb, Eon, Kia, Nissan, Mercedes, Renault and other will be participating in the testing.
